AGRICULTURE NEWS - South Africans should prepare themselves for heavy rainfall and a preview to the coming winter as a cold front makes its way across the central and south-eastern parts of the country over the next few days.
But, unfortunately, the outlook for rain in some of the areas most affected by drought remained slim.
The South African Weather Service (SAWS) has issued a warning that widespread thundershowers are expected over the central, southern and eastern provinces in the coming days.
